当前位置: 首页 > news >正文

重庆网站制作公司电话口碑营销5t理论

重庆网站制作公司电话,口碑营销5t理论,防红短网址一键生成,网站打不开 别的电脑能打开本文介绍Qt窗体的布局。 Qt窗体的布局分为手动布局和自动布局#xff0c;手动布局即靠手工排布各控件的位置。而自动布局则是根据选择的布局类型自动按此类型排布各控件的位置#xff0c;使用起来比较方便#xff0c;本文主要介绍Qt的自动布局。 1.垂直布局 垂直布局就是…本文介绍Qt窗体的布局。 Qt窗体的布局分为手动布局和自动布局手动布局即靠手工排布各控件的位置。而自动布局则是根据选择的布局类型自动按此类型排布各控件的位置使用起来比较方便本文主要介绍Qt的自动布局。 1.垂直布局 垂直布局就是将其中的控件按垂直方向等间隔排布。如下图所示。 代码方式 QWidget *window new QWidget;QPushButton *button1 new QPushButton(One);QPushButton *button2 new QPushButton(Two);QVBoxLayout *layout new QVBoxLayout;layout-addWidget(button1);layout-addWidget(button2);window-setLayout(layout);window-show();2.水平布局 垂直布局就是将其中的控件按水平方向等间隔排布。如下图所示。 代码方式 QWidget *window new QWidget;QPushButton *button1 new QPushButton(One);QPushButton *button2 new QPushButton(Two);QHBoxLayout *layout new QHBoxLayout;layout-addWidget(button1);layout-addWidget(button2);window-setLayout(layout);window-show();3.栅格布局 垂直布局就是将其中的控件按栅格对齐。如果控件的位置不处于水平或垂直对齐的方向则自动按矩阵的方式排布。如下图所示。 代码方式 QWidget *window new QWidget;QPushButton *button1 new QPushButton(One);QPushButton *button2 new QPushButton(Two);QGridLayout *layout new QGridLayout;layout-addWidget(button1, 0, 0);layout-addWidget(button2, 1, 1);window-setLayout(layout);window-show();4.表单布局 表单布局主要用于Label控件和EditLine控件或其他控件按表格N*2的方式进行排布。如下图所示。 代码方式 QWidget *window new QWidget;QPushButton *button1 new QPushButton(One);QPushButton *button2 new QPushButton(Two);QLabel *label1 new QLabel(one:);QLabel *label2 new QLabel(two:);QFormLayout *layout new QFormLayout;layout-insertRow(0, label1, button1);layout-insertRow(1, label2, button2);window-setLayout(layout);window-show();5.弹簧控件 弹簧控件配合以上布局可以实现控件随窗口变换自动缩放的效果。如下图的排布可实现窗口拖拽及最大化时控件也随着自动缩放及最大化。 弹簧控件构造函数 QSpacerItem(int w, int h, QSizePolicy::Policy hPolicy QSizePolicy::Minimum, QSizePolicy::Policy vPolicy QSizePolicy::Minimum) 代码方式 QWidget *widget new QWidget;QVBoxLayout *layout new QVBoxLayout(widget);QPushButton *button new QPushButton(按钮);QLineEdit *lineEdit new QLineEdit;QSpacerItem *spaceItem new QSpacerItem(20, 40, QSizePolicy::Expanding, QSizePolicy::Maximum);layout-addWidget(button);layout-addItem(spaceItem);layout-addWidget(lineEdit);widget-setLayout(layout);widget-show(); 总结本文介绍了Qt窗体的布局。
http://www.hkea.cn/news/14278214/

相关文章:

  • 易县做网站的在哪wordpress汉化插件库
  • 网站原创文章网站模板建站教程视频
  • 网站模板是怎么制作新余网站网站建设
  • 旅游网站平台建设方案策划书服饰网站建设模板
  • 网站关键词百度排名在下降wordpress 阅读统计
  • 做网站图片为什么不清晰12306网站建设
  • 从化做网站做网站架构需要什么工具
  • 做系统和做网站哪个简单一些android studio模拟器
  • 番禺网站建设公司有哪些网站的布局分类
  • iis网站建设网站建设新闻分享
  • 桥梁建设网站wordpress文章价格产品价格
  • 简述网站制作流程图wordpress常规选项
  • frontpage怎么改网站名字小程序制作怎么导入题库
  • 营销型网站建设的概念容易导致网站作弊的几个嫌疑
  • 常熟做网站价格做一个小网站多少钱
  • 搜索网页内容seo服务加盟
  • 如何在微信公众平台上建立微网站智慧团建电脑版登录
  • 网上请人做软件的网站商城网站建设要多少钱
  • 现在企业做网站用什么软件在百度建免费网站吗
  • 腾讯云 建网站网站备案名称查询
  • 武清做网站的公司钢材料 网站建设 中企动力
  • 高校文明校园建设专题网站深圳保障性住房有哪些
  • 精品网站建设比较好短视频平台推广
  • 做网站要有哪些知识网站建设 百度贴吧
  • 网站备案 两个域名网站建设需要哪些素材
  • 最专业微网站建设价格内容营销策划方案
  • 城乡建设杂志社官方网站医院网站建设具体内容
  • 英文网站title电销系统开发
  • 6做网站做母婴的网站有哪些
  • 鄂尔多斯市建设网站临沂百度联系方式